Graphs:
- Radar Cross Section Graphs
Carrying units of m2, this quantity describes the relative energy
density of the scattered field normalized by the distance from the scattering
object.RCS of a conducting sphere in free space for the monostatic case: when
the observation direction also called the backscatter direction. At
lowfrequencies the RCS is proportional to λ−4; this is the range of Rayleigh
scattering, showing that higher-frequency light scatters more strongly from
microscopic particles in the atmosphere. At high frequencies the result
approaches that of geometrical optics, and the RCS becomes the interception area
of the sphere, πa2.
